An insurance provider needs certain essential information if you want to get car insurance with a learner’s permit in New York. You have to provide your name, address, date of birth, vehicle’s make and model, VIN (Vehicle Identification Number), permit number, and driving history. Additionally, you may also be required to provide a letter from your driving trainer attesting to your safe driving skills.
Once you’ve supplied the necessary details, the insurance company will assess the level of risk associated with insuring you and provide you with a quote. You can then decide whether to proceed with the insurance purchase.
It’s important to remember that having car insurance with a learner’s permit doesn’t exempt you from adhering to all the traffic rules. Any illegal driving activities could lead to the voiding of your insurance policy.
When you have a permit, you typically need to be added to a parent or guardian’s existing insurance policy. However, if you own a vehicle or plan to drive regularly, some insurers may allow you to get your own policy with a licensed driver listed as a co-driver.

Compare Rates: Shop around and compare insurance premium rates from different insurance providers to find cheap ones.
Seek Discounts: Check if your parents or guardians can help you get a discount on your insurance. Sometimes, adding yourself to their policy can be more cost-effective.
Defensive Driving Course: Taking a defensive driving course may help to lower your insurance cost.
Drive Safely: Safe driving and obeying traffic laws helps to maintain a clean driving record.
It’s very essential to get proper insurance coverage even during the learning phase because it protects you and others on the road. Always remember to follow the guidelines set by the state of New York for drivers with learner’s permits, such as adhering to curfew hours and passenger restrictions.

Is it possible to get car insurance with only a permit in New York?
Yes! In New York, you can even insure a car with just a learner’s permit. Most new drivers are added to their parent or guardian’s policy, but some insurers also offer individual coverage with a supervising driver included.
Do I need to have a licensed driver on my policy if I have only a permit?
Yes, the majority of insurance providers will insist on a fully licensed driver (such as a guardian or parent) being placed on the policy if you are driving with a permit only. This is to assure coverage and safety throughout your learning process.
Will having insurance with a permit reduce future rates?
Yes! Beginning your insurance history while you hold a permit will enable you to qualify for better rates down the road. Insurers like to offer better premiums to more experienced drivers with fewer claims on their record—even if that experience started under a permit.
Can you get auto insurance with a permit in NY?
Yes, you can get auto insurance with a learner’s permit in NY. Many insurers allow it, especially if a licensed driver is included on the policy.
Can I get insurance without a license in NY?
It’s possible, but harder. Some companies may insure you without a license if you list a primary driver who is licensed. You’ll need to explain why you’re insuring the vehicle.
